Summer Youth Pass Gives Kids Unlimited Bus Rides

The $20 bus pass is for youth to get around town, from Calistoga down to American Canyon, or even as far as the Vallejo Ferry Terminal, Amtrak, or BART.

Napa, Calif. – To help kids stay active and engaged in activities and hobbies this summer, Vine Transit is offering unlimited rides to youth ages 6 to 18 for $20.

The Summer Youth Pass is good on all Vine bus routes, including on-demand rides within city and town limits.

“Whether your child wants to visit a Calistoga concert in the park, explore Napa’s River-to-Ridge Trail, or go to a swim lesson in American Canyon, we’ve got them covered,” said NVTA Executive Director Kate Miller. “For families who want to take transit even further to services like BART, Amtrak, or the Vallejo Ferry, the savings can add up. Visiting friends and exploring the Napa Valley has never been more affordable.”

To purchase a pass, choose from the following options:

  • Purchase securely online.
  • Call Vine Transit customer service at 707-251-2800.
  • Visit the Vine Transit customer service office at 625 Burnell Street in Napa.

The Summer Youth Pass can be used from June 15 to August 15. You must be ages 6 to 18 to use the pass.
